Google moved
from API 31 to API 32 on March build. This means that, for all that's code related,
it's like we're not on Android 12 anymore, we're on
Android 12 L or
12.1 or
whatever the official name is.
This
change was so drastic that
not even Apktool is function properly to decompile/recompile APK's back (something that was really required to make this MOD FULLY work).

"The correct setup" for the time being should be this:
1 - Magisk Stable v24.3 (or any latest Canary)
2 - LSposed Zygisk version module
3 - Addon Features for Pixel devices LITE module v21
4 - AOSPMods Canary 005 APK
5 - AOSPMods Canary 005 Magisk zip (if you want to try the light QS panel...which is still on BETA phase)
If you face a boot loop after flashing all this, please try the "same setup" without the AOSPMods magisk zip...that is, flash all until step 4!
I'm suspecting something is wrong with one of the overlays included on that zip...
